#ThrowbackThursday - DJ Jazzy Jeff & The Fresh Prince: Summertime


QUICKLY HIT PLAY – QUICKLY. While the sun is still out for goodness sake PLAY THIS SONG otherwise people will look at you like “Summer time? Mate, the sky and the concrete are the same colour right now, put down the weed.” 6 months after I was born way back in December 1990, Will “Fresh Prince” Smith and DJ Jazzy Jeff dropped this Grammy award winning interpolation of Kool & The Gang’s Summer Madness, cementing the number one spot in the US charts, and a respectable #8 in the elusive UK one. The song is one of the Fresh Prince’s most popular songs and for good reason: no other song embodies that ‘call up your friends to chill in the park’, 'appreciate the choice of clothes the opposite sex elects to wear at this time of year (or lack of)', ‘dust your sunglasses off and take selfies’ kind of vibe quite like this one, and it’s beautiful.
